The stamp features a portrait of Günther Ramin, a German organist and choirmaster, with the denomination '100 DM' and 'DEUTSCHLAND' visible. The background appears to be an abstract representation, possibly hinting at musical scores.
This stamp, issued in 1998, commemorates the 100th anniversary of the birth of Günther Ramin (1898–1956), a highly influential German organist, conductor, and composer renowned for his interpretations of Johann Sebastian Bach.
